I think this stuff of encoding is important. Maybe we should ask an entry in F.A.Q saying something like this:
" When I type certain characters a '?' is displayed instead of the real problem.
The standard font in Pharo covers the latin-15 character set. Which means it should be able to display áÃé, with a Unicode conversion table. However, all input outside ascii range is in Unicode, so to display those you need to - Import a Font which includes them. (Like the DejaVu FT-font included previously) - Change the fonts used to the one you know support those characters from the world right click menu, in System -> Preferences -> System fonts. "

Interesting...I copied 'Fonts' folder from older Pharo dist. to new one and now I can see all system fonts installed on my Mac. So I have chosen Monaco font for code and all characters were displayed correctly. So problem is gone, I hope. Thanks for your time.
